The format of a speech

That is a simple format you may use to engage your audience with a well-organized piece of writing, although you can make your format for the speech.

  • Let’s begin with a quotation: A quote on the subject is a good starting point.
  • Simply a quick introduction: Then give a short introduction to the topic.
  • The existing circumstance: The next step is to describe the existing circumstances, the issue (including any), and the steps required to enhance it.
  • Understanding the topic: by gathering the information, you can learn interesting and engaging angles of the subject. Impress the audience by including these points in your speech.
  • Conclusion: With a suggestion or viewpoint, finish your speech. Don’t forget to list the steps whenever you offer a solution to an issue.

Topics for Different Persuasive Speeches

  • Factual Persuasive Speech – Use data and examples to demonstrate the veracity or falsity of the claim.
  • Value Persuasive Speech – Dispute whether a particular action is ethically right or wrong
  • Policy persuasive speech – Aims to enhance legislation, policies, and other things.
